The remarkable aspect of the Kerala lottery program is not only the substantial cash prizes but also the positive impact it has on the community. Operated by the Government of Kerala, the lottery department was established to fund various welfare programs across the state. One notable initiative supported by lottery proceeds is the Karunya scheme, which provides financial aid to residents facing serious medical conditions.
Through this support, the Kerala Lottery Department has helped more than 27,000 individuals afford treatment for life-threatening illnesses, including cancer and other severe health issues. This focus on social welfare showcases the department's commitment to improving the lives of those less fortunate.
With each draw, thousands of tickets are sold, generating significant revenue for state welfare programs. Lottery tickets for the Fifty Fifty lottery are available for purchase weekly, with each draw featuring approximately 108 lakh tickets up for grabs. Participants are reminded to claim their prizes responsibly. Winners are encouraged to surrender their winning tickets within 30 days to confirm their eligibility and avoid any complications. The official results will also be published in the Kerala Government Gazette, underscoring the legitimacy and transparency of the lottery process.
